Transaction 13111abf31196f4dcb89bcd7920f2b9811803596bba78c1780ad4acca29a993a
2 Input
2 Outputs
- 13111abf31196f4dcb89bcd7920f2b9811803596bba78c1780ad4acca29a993a:0
- 13111abf31196f4dcb89bcd7920f2b9811803596bba78c1780ad4acca29a993a:1
value 2000000
address 1TvVCqt8PXDCGA1TCs2qwVQN89dtKfoaQ
value 157457
address 1y17hUnXsoMrMcwx4WUh1rCcpZ2ptTgyh